EDITORS COMMENTS
This print captures the essence of a circus performance in 1888. Painted by renowned artist Henri de Toulouse-Lautrec, "At the Circus: Horsewoman" showcases a tambourine with oil on vellum painting that measures 26.7 cm in diameter. The artwork is housed at The Art Institute of Chicago, IL, USA. In this vibrant piece, we see two individuals engaged in an acrobatic act within the circus arena. A skilled horsewoman gracefully balances atop her majestic steed while holding a tambourine, ready to create melodic rhythms that will accompany their daring performance. Toulouse-Lautrec's use of color adds depth and life to the scene, capturing the excitement and energy of the moment. The blurred motion suggests dynamic movement and agitation as both performers showcase their skills with precision and grace. The painting not only highlights the beauty of these talented individuals but also serves as a testament to Toulouse-Lautrec's mastery in capturing human form and emotion through his artistry.
